Here are some of the best places in Europe to go swimming in spring:
Costa del Sol, Spain

This sunny region of Spain is known for its beautiful beaches and warm weather. With temperatures in the mid-20s Celsius (70s Fahrenheit), you can enjoy the warm Mediterranean waters even in early spring.
Algarve, Portugal

Another popular destination for beach lovers, the Algarve in southern Portugal offers miles of golden sand beaches and crystal-clear waters. The water can be a bit chilly in early spring, but still pleasant for swimming.
French Riviera, France

The French Riviera is a glamorous destination that offers plenty of opportunities for swimming, with beaches like Nice and Cannes offering both sand and pebble beaches.
Lake Como, Italy

Lake Como in northern Italy is a beautiful spot for swimming, with its clear waters and stunning mountain views. Spring is a great time to visit before the crowds arrive in summer.
Greek Islands, Greece

The Greek Islands are a popular destination for beach lovers, with many islands offering secluded coves and turquoise waters. The weather can be a bit unpredictable in spring, but you can still enjoy some warm and sunny days.
Dubrovnik, Croatia

Dubrovnik is a historic city located on the Adriatic coast of Croatia, and it’s a great place to go swimming in the spring. The water can be a bit chilly, but the stunning views and crystal-clear waters make it worth it.
